CM Manohar Lal announced: There has been an increase in the scholarship given to the children of laborers.

Haryana Chief Minister Manohar Lal interacted directly with the workers and their children registered with the Haryana Building and Other Construction Workers Welfare Board through audio conferencing from New Delhi today. Where he congratulated the country on getting the gift of a new parliament. He said that Prime Minister Narendra Modi made the countrymen proud today by inaugurating the Parliament House with Vedic law and legislation. On this occasion, the PM also honored the workers, giving importance to the contribution of the workers in the construction of the Parliament House.

CM increased the amount of scholarship given to the children of laborers

The Chief Minister said that following this guidance of the Prime Minister, the Haryana government is also giving full respect to the workers. He said that workers have an important contribution in every construction and Today the country is becoming self-sufficient only on the strength of the workers. Taking a step further in this direction, the CM announced to increase the scholarship amount given to the children of the laborers by the Haryana Labor Welfare Board. He has increased the amount of Rs 7 thousand for class 9th to 10th, Rs 7750 for class 11th to 12th and Rs 8500 for higher education to Rs 10,000 in all three categories.
